IN BOOK THREE OF THE DRAG QUEEN MYSTERY SERIES, POPULAR DRAG ENTERTAINERS AUTUMN GOLDLEAF AND COOKIE LA RUSE ARE LOOKING FORWARD TO AN EXCITING NEW ADVENTURE DURING THEIR LAS VEGAS RESIDENCY. STILL, THEIR LIVES ARE ONCE AGAIN DSIRUPTED BY THE MURDER OF BURLESQUE ARTISTE DEJA BLEU WHEN DEJA'S ONLY FRIEND, RETIRED LIBRARIAN PENNY, ASKS AUTUMN AND COOKIE TO FIND DEJA'S KILLER, THE QUEENS RELUCTANTLY AGREE. WITH THE HELP OF SISTER QUEENS, SAKURA SATO, DEE DEE GUNZ, AND HANDSOME DETECTIVE ZACHARY BAKER, AUTUMN AND COOKIE FIND THEMSELVES DRAWN INTO PAST TRAGEDIES, HIGH CRIMES, A WORLD OF ILLUSION AND A KING'S RANSOM IN FABULOUS COSTUMES.
THE DRAG QUEEN MYSTERY SERIES IS DESCRIBED BY FANS OF AUTUMN AND COOKIE AS RU PAUL MEETS AGATHA CHRISTIE.

Stephanie Dargon Luce, was born and raised in Boston, Massachusetts, and is a graduate of the University of Wisconsin. She currently resides near Madison, Wisconsin with her husband and rescue dogs. Stephanie has a lifelong love of writing and, in 2016, translated her love for mysteries and drag entertainment into the Drag Queen Mystery series.
